New Firmware Updater

Don't know if I've been the only one with trouble getting the firmware updater to recognize my device, but iRiver global has released a new updater that solved my problem. You can find it here.

The version is V2.5.0.0 versus 2.2.0.0 on iRiver America's support site. This is not a firmware upgrade, but apparently fixed some recognition issues that at least I was having using my desktop with Windows XP SP2 and WMP11 (which I was strangely not having with my laptop).

Haven't seen any problems posted like this here, but I hope it helps someone.

The problem that was fixed in 2.5 was to do with other USB storage devices on the system. If you had anything like a card reader 2.2 couldn't find your device.
